My first time, ever. Never used one before. I installed a Extang rollup soft vinyl cover. I plan on only keeping it on in the winter and plan on taking it off when spring arrives. I use the bed of the truck a lot in milder weather and do not want to be encumbered with the tonneau cover and its hardware.

Having to constantly shovel snow out of the bed of the truck in the winter is a chore I can do without. The security a cover provides for stuff in the bed is nice, as is the weather protection it provides.

I do have a concern about the bed not drying out properly since there is not air circulation in the bed when the truck is parked. There is a small gap between the tailgate and the rear edge of the cover and, with my truck parked facing downhill, some moisture is going to get in.
